Transaction d95f33bc79881ecf1e239ae83074fbf2f9b70af11251c154d93cb095b8317185
1 Input
1 Output
-
d95f33bc79881ecf1e239ae83074fbf2f9b70af11251c154d93cb095b8317185:0
- value
- 5976519
- script pubkey
- OP_0 OP_PUSHBYTES_20 a884831cb2879caba5aab9f80f1b9267cb355276
- address
- bc1q4zzgx89js7w2hfd2h8uq7xujvl9n25nk5pvl4k